Operating Expenses
Costs associated with the day-to-day operations of a business, excluding direct labor and materials.
Future Taxpayers
Individuals or entities that will be responsible for contributing to government revenues through taxes in the future.
Promised Benefits
The guaranteed or expected advantages or returns, often from investments, insurance policies, or employment contracts.
Real Rate
refers to the interest rate adjusted for inflation, providing a more accurate measure of the true cost of borrowing or the real yield on an investment.
